Branken Moor arrived 3 Dec 1841, barque 402 tons, Smith master, from Cork 1 Aug 1841 to Port Phillip Images 148-153 notes
Passengers Miss Emily and Julia Gavin, Mrs Large and 3 chn, Messrs Mason, and Rosche, 158 bounty under Dr Large,
Neither the Australian Maritime Museum nor The National Maritime Museum, at Greenwich, has a likeness of the "Branken Moor".
List of Immigrants (British Subjects) who have been introduced into the Colony of New South Wales, under the Regulations of 3rd March 1840, by Mr. Jonathan B. Were of Melbourne, Port Phillip, in pursuance of the unconditional authority conveyed to that Gentleman in the letter of the Colonial Secretary dated 11th March 1840, and who arrived at Port Phillip in the Ship "Branken Moor" Captain David Smith, from Cork on the 3rd December 1841, under the Medical Superintendence of Doctor Large, with assistance of 3 Mates - Richard Birch, John Kelly and Thomas Paine.
Branken Moor Part 1 and Part 2 passenger list and Notes, transcribed by Veronica Maude Bates 67 in families, and as singles - 47 females and 39 males, total 153.
18 Families, 7 couples without children, 11 with Children - Under 1 Males 1, Females 1, 1 to 7 years Males 5, Females 10, 7 to 15 yrs Males 6 Females 6, total 67
Count is 5 Staff, 6 extras, 67 in families (13 sons, 19 daus), 39 single males and 47 single females in the Bounty system. Total apart from about 15 sailors and other servants, 266 named persons.
Ellen and Charles Bunworth, and Ann and Henry Legge each are accompanied by 6 children
Protestants 28, Roman Catholics 124. Adults who can read and write 45, can read only 26, neither Read/Write 50,
Amount of Bounty in Pounds - Families 917, Single Males 703, Single Females 912, Total 2532 pounds

To depart 23 Apr 1842 for England with 9 in the Steerage, Mr and Mrs Lucas, Dr and Mrs Ohara, Mrs Jennings and servant
Mrs Bear, Captain Lewis, Mr Barton, Mr Fellingham, Mr Lynch, cargo 1174 bales of wool, 18 tons of wattle bark.
